Can a 4-20mA be run in the same cable as a 24v discrete to PLC? by seemoreoptions-1 in PLC

[–]Kaaaaaaaahn 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Yes, it will work no problem. The specific wire in your image is way overkill for this application, however. Do you have a real reason to use steel wire armored cable? If not, 18 awg two or three conductor with a drain wire and overall foil shield will be fine.

Question for those of you who switched from Hilton…. by Hot_Sauce404 in marriott

[–]Kaaaaaaaahn 3 points4 points  (0 children)

Switched two years ago, although with promos I did make diamond last year. Also titanium.

Biggest thing I miss is being able to select the specific room during online check-in. It's so nice to avoid being across from the elevator, not facing the highway, or on the first floor but only when the floorplan is good for the first floor (e.g. not next to the kitchen).

Otherwise, Marriott's NICE hotels are more common and much nicer than Hilton's (WA excluded). Marriott's points go farther too, but still not great and often Amex FHR with points is a better deal.

Marriott more common outside US, but Hampton's still win in small town USA.

The United/Air Canada status is real nice too.

Try it for a year. You can always do a diamond extension if you change your mind (and qualify for it).
